Core Performance and Engineering
At the heart of the HITWAY Electric Bike lies a 250W motor, a configuration that strikes a balance between efficiency and compliance with UK road laws. The motor’s output is optimised for urban terrain, providing sufficient power to tackle inclines and accelerate smoothly in stop-start traffic without overwhelming newer riders. Paired with a 36V 10.4Ah lithium-ion battery, the bike offers a commendable range of 40–80km on a single charge, depending on riding mode and terrain. This flexibility ensures that most commuters can complete a week’s worth of short-distance trips without frequent recharging.
The three-speed gear system (15km/h, 20km/h, and 25km/h) allows riders to adjust their pace according to traffic conditions or personal preference. Many have praised the intuitive handling, particularly the seamless transition between assist levels, which eliminates the jerky acceleration common in entry-level e-bikes. The LCD display, positioned centrally on the handlebars, offers real-time updates on speed, battery life, and selected mode, ensuring riders remain informed without distraction.
Design and Practicality
HITWAY’s focus on ergonomics and accessibility is evident in the bike’s step-through frame, a feature frequently highlighted for its convenience. The low-slung design not only simplifies mounting and dismounting but also accommodates riders wearing skirts or dresses, making it a practical choice for diverse wardrobes. Coupled with an adjustable saddle, the bike promotes an upright riding posture, reducing strain on the back and shoulders during extended commutes.
Weighing 26.4kg, the bike’s carbon steel frame strikes a balance between durability and manageability. While not the lightest option available, the robust construction ensures stability on uneven surfaces, a trait appreciated by those navigating pothole-ridden city streets. The inclusion of a pre-installed 25kg luggage rack and reinforced front basket bracket further enhances utility, allowing riders to transport groceries, work bags, or other essentials effortlessly. Several users have noted the convenience of these additions, emphasising how they eliminate the need for aftermarket accessories.
Safety and Reliability
Safety remains a cornerstone of the HITWAY Electric Bike’s design. Dual mechanical disc brakes deliver consistent stopping power in all weather conditions, a critical feature for urban environments where sudden stops are inevitable. Riders have reported confidence in the braking system’s responsiveness, particularly during wet commutes.
The integrated lighting system—comprising a front LED headlight and rear taillight—enhances visibility during early morning or evening rides. This feature has been lauded as a significant safety upgrade, especially for those navigating dimly lit cycle paths or busy roads. Additionally, reflectors on the wheels and frame ensure the bike remains conspicuous to other road users.

Battery Efficiency and Charging
The 36V 10.4Ah battery is removable, enabling off-bike charging—a practical feature for apartment dwellers or those without garage access. Charging time averages four to six hours, and the battery’s placement low on the frame contributes to the bike’s balanced centre of gravity. Riders commuting within the 40km range typically recharge twice weekly, though those using higher assist levels may need to plug in more frequently.
A subtle but appreciated detail is the battery lock, which secures the unit to the frame, deterring theft. This design consideration reflects HITWAY’s attention to real-world usability, ensuring peace of mind for riders parking in public spaces.

Limitations and Considerations
While overwhelmingly positive, some feedback touches on areas for improvement. The bike’s weight, though contributing to stability, can pose challenges when lifting onto public transport or carrying upstairs. Additionally, the lack of suspension may deter those prioritising comfort on exceptionally rough routes, though the wide tyres mitigate this to a degree.
